1. Setting Up Your Workspace: Tools and Materials
Before you start painting, it’s crucial to set up a comfortable workspace. Gather your materials: high-quality acrylic paints in shades of red, orange, yellow, blue, green, and black; a variety of brushes (round, flat, and detail brushes); a canvas or sturdy paper; and water for rinsing your brushes. Don’t forget a palette for mixing colors and a cup of water for cleaning brushes. Oh, and a smock or old shirt – accidents happen, especially when you’re having fun! 😂
2. Sketching the Koi Fish: A Blueprint for Success
The key to a successful painting lies in a well-planned sketch. Start by lightly drawing the outline of your koi fish on the canvas. Koi fish have a distinctive shape with flowing lines, so use gentle curves to capture their graceful form. Think of them as swimming clouds with fins and scales. Once you’re happy with the sketch, it’s time to bring your fish to life with color. 🐟🌈
3. Painting Techniques: Bringing Your Koi to Life
Now comes the fun part – painting! Begin by laying down the base colors. Use a mix of red, orange, and yellow for the vibrant body of the koi. Add depth by layering darker shades along the edges and lighter tones in the center. For the scales, use a small detail brush to add subtle highlights and shadows, giving your fish a realistic texture. Don’t forget to paint the eyes last – they’re the windows to the soul of your koi! 🪄👀
4. Adding the Pond Environment: Water and Surroundings
To complete your masterpiece, it’s essential to paint the environment around your koi fish. Use shades of blue and green to create a serene pond background. Add ripples and reflections to give the impression of water movement. You can also include elements like lily pads or underwater plants to enhance the scene. Remember, the environment should complement the koi, not overpower it. 🌿💧
5. Final Touches: Enhancing Your Painting
The final touches are what make your painting truly unique. Consider adding highlights to the scales with a white paint to catch the light. You can also experiment with different brush strokes to add texture to the water and surroundings. Lastly, sign your artwork proudly – it’s a symbol of your hard work and creativity. 🎉🎨
